Catering

The aim of the Catering Department is to provide good, nutritious and tasty home-cooked food. Using fresh ingredients and making all our meals on site ensures that we know exactly what is in the food we serve at lunchtime. We use almost no processed food. Our burgers, nuggets, smoothies, soups, pies and pizzas are all made here. We want our food to look and taste good and to appeal to young children, not to be full of additives, fat and extra salt.

We want the children at Bute House to enjoy and look forward to lunchtime. We know that they do, by the comments we receive from children and parents (as well as the wistful comments of former pupils!). It is also good to see that the children, when choosing from the menu items, are willing to try new tastes, love homemade soups and smoothies, eat salad with enthusiasm and, although there are clear favourites like macaroni cheese and chicken pie, other dishes are becoming more popular as time goes on. Spaghetti bolognese is now one of the top choices, as are curries and meatballs with noodles. The children's Food Council meets the chef regularly to discuss options and new ideas.

The children sit at tables of ten, say grace and are served by an adult or an older girl. They learn table manners and are encouraged to eat a good meal and try new things. They then help to clear and wipe the table and, in the case of younger children, lay the table for the next sitting.

Lunch is one of the highlights of the day due to our professional chef and his team and it is very encouraging to feel that, whilst here at Bute House and when they leave the school, the children will have good and positive memories and attitudes about food and school meals.
